This place sucks.

From: -Anonymous-
Date posted: 7/21/2009
Years at this apartment: 2009 - 2009
 
We currently rent from Benson Downs, and have been here since March. We've had an enormous problem with our neighbors and their children upstairs, and this isn't counting the unwillingness of the staff to do anything about it. The apartments look glorious from an outsider view, but are subpar once the honeymoon is over.
Our upstairs neighbors suck. They have tons of cars that take up our already crowded parking, and preschool age children that thump around and scream and cry at all hours of the day and night. They do laundry at 3am, and have been known to have screaming toddlers on their balcony at midnight. Their children litter the stairwell with trash (juice containers and wrappers), and the noise is a persistent and definite problem. We've complained to the staff numerous times, but their response is to assure us the problem will be fixed, all the while doing nothing about it but possibly leaving a note on their door (Oh no, a big bad note!).
The staff doesn't keep track of how many vehicles there are per unit, and where these vehicles should and should not be parking. In our contract, it states that non-running vehicles will be towed, but an old, beat up Accord has been parked in the same spot (a valuable spot, at that - right in the warzone for parking between three buildings) for several weeks at a time (very obviously not moving, hence its deflated tire), and this is overlooked. Our covered parking spot is surprisingly far away from our apartment, for there being so many that are closer and seemingly unused. Some of the covered parking does go unused, because THERE ARE CLOSER VISITOR PARKING SPOTS TO TENANTS' APARTMENTS.
The facilities look great, until one starts using them daily. The fitness center is vacant much of the time, but when it's crowded, it's crowded. And who ever heard of a fitness room that wasn't properly ventilated, or even air-conditioned' That room gets much too hot far too quickly (esp. when the sun is out), and there are no windows that one can open. Somehow, they can air condition the rest of the building, but not this room.
Their 'media center' is composed of two dinosaur computers that aren't hooked up to a printer, and a copy machine. There is no fax machine or printer as we were told. Their pool area is nice enough, but gets easily crowded on a hot day, as the pool is on the small side (and shallow).
Maintenance is okay, other than that it's taken them 3 tries to fix the only big burner on our stove. It still won't heat things properly, and they've been here multiple times for the problem. There were at least three other problems we had to have them fix. The master bedroom and livingroom lights didn't work, and the towel rack in the master bedroom wasn't secured properly and so fell off. Our bathroom door is crooked and doesn't shut securely or properly (hinges are off) and they said they can't do anything about that' I'm a college student that knows nothing about carpentry, and [[I]] could probably fix it.
Their office staff sucks. I went into the office the day after we moved in to secure a key for the gate that actually worked (we got trapped outside, waiting for somebody else to come through the night before because the cards they gave us didn't work!), and I was interrogated by Michael as to if I was on the lease and what my age was, and if the friend that happened to be with me was living there too. Jxsus! I just want a way to get into my apartment complex, where I live!
At that, their gate sucks. At first, it was to open sometime in the morning for the day, and close at 6pm sharp for the night. Now, they just leave it open all night. What is the point of my paying more for secured entry when it is an inadequate system to begin with (the gate closes so slowly that another car can easily get in, not to mention that when you nose your car in there, the sensor throws the gate back open for another 10 seconds), and now they're not even using it'! Worthless.
This month, due to a miscommunication, one of our checks didn't go through. Instead of a concerned phone call to any of the three tenants in our apartment, they instead lodged a three-day pay or vacate notice behind the placard bearing our apartment number, and offered no communication otherwise. What would have happened if a gust of wind came down our breezeway and blew that notice away, with how precariously it was placed' Or some jerk from the building (maybe the neighbors that we've been complaining about') had taken it off' They would have thrown us out on the curb, no questions asked.
It's just surprising how little they care about their tenants, and how much it costs to live here while the amenities are simply "okay".
I wouldn't recommend Benson Downs to anybody. This place eats!
